PEPPER
Put a card from your Discard Pile
on top of your Deck. If you do not
have any cards in your Discard Pile,
you cannot play this card.
POTATO
Reveal the top card of your Deck. If its an Artichoke,
compost it, otherwise, place it on top of your Discard
Pile. If you don’t have a Deck, shufe your Discard Pile
to make one. If you don’t have a Discard Pile or
a Deck, you cannot play this card.
PEAS
Reveal the top two cards from the Garden Stack.
Put one on top of your Discard Pile, the other on top
of an opponents Discard Pile. If there are no cards
left in the Garden Stack, you cannot play this card.
ONION
Compost an Artichoke. Put this card on top
of another players Discard Pile. If you have
no Artichokes in your hand, you cannot
play this card.
LEEK
Reveal the top card of an opponents Deck, and put it on top of
their Discard Pile or into your hand. If they do not have a Deck,
they must shufe their Discard Pile to make one. If they don’t
have a Discard Pile or a Deck, you can’t play this card on them.
EGGPLANT
Compost an Artichoke, along with this card. Then, all
players simultaneously pass two cards (of their choice)
face-down to the player on their left. If a player has
fewer than two cards in their hand, they pass as
many as they are able to. You may end up with a
different number of cards in your hand than what
you started with.
CORN
Play this card with an Artichoke. Then put
a card from the Garden Row on top of
your Deck. If you have no Artichokes in
your hand, you cannot play this card.
BROCCOLI
Compost an Artichoke if your hand has three or more
Artichokes. If you have fewer than three Artichokes in
your hand, you cannot play this card.
BEET
Choose an opponent. Each of you blindly draws a
random card from the other’s hand and reveals it
simultaneously. If both are Artichokes compost them,
otherwise, swap them. If you get a non-Artichoke card,
you may play it during the same turn. If your opponent
ends up with fewer than ve cards in their hand after
composting an Artichoke, they draw back up do not
to ve cards until the end of their next turn.

2-4 players Ages 10+
Contents
100 cards
40 Artichoke
6 each: Beet, Broccoli, Carrot, Corn, Eggplant,
Leek, Onion, Peas, Pepper, Potato
4 player reference cards
Overview
Welcome to Abandon All Artichokes, a fast-paced,
deck-wrecking” card game. Harvest vegetables to build
your deck and gain new powers, while abandoning
Artichokes by any means necessary. If you’re able to
draw a hand free of Artichokes at the end of your turn,
you win the game!
1. Give each player a reference card.
2. Separate all 40 Artichoke cards from the rest of
the stack. Deal 10 Artichoke cards face-down to
each player, forming their Personal Deck, and
return any left over to the tin.
4. Reveal the top 5 cards of the Garden Stack and place them
side-by-side to form the Garden Row. Leave space on the other
side of the Garden Stack for the Community Compost Pile
composted cards will go here as the game progresses.
5. Each player draws 5 Artichokes from their Personal Deck into
their hand. You are ready to begin!
3. Shufe the remaining (non-Artichoke) cards and put them
face-down in the middle of the playing area to form the
.Garden Stack

5. 5 cards from the top of your Personal Deck Draw
to rell your hand.
If your Deck runs out before you’ve drawn all
 5cards,drawasmanyasyoucan,shufeyour
 DiscardPiletoformanewDeck,andnishdrawing.
If both your Deck and Discard Pile run out, you may
end up with fewer than 5 cards in your hand.
 DonotshufeyourDiscardPiletoformanewDeck
unless you are unable to draw a hand of 5 cards at the
end of your turn, or a Potato or Leek card is played
and the target Deck is empty.
Ending the Game
When you rell your hand at the end of your turn, if none of
the cards are Artichokes, you immediately win the game!
Reveal your hand and say, “Abandon all Artichokes!”
Important: You do not win if your hand has
no Artichokes in the middle of your
(or another player’s) turn.
